Ram Point is a nature reserve in Connecticut, at a modelled 0 m. Wintechog Hill stands 139 m to the north-northeast, 9.5 miles off. The nearest named place is Noank Town Dock Beach, a beach 0.5 miles away. State Routes 49 & 14A passes 9.3 miles off.
Private, Open To Public Without Fee
- Operated by
- Avalonia Land Conservancy
